Mastercard Names New President Of Canadian Operations

PYMNTS

Mastercard announced on Thursday (May 30) the appointment of Sasha Krstic as president of the company’s Canadian operations. The executive started with Mastercard in 2004 and has served in multiple roles, including sales, customer management, services and product development. Krstic is a graduate of the University of Alberta.

When QSRs Think Really Outside The Box In The Innovation Race

PYMNTS

The realm of quick service restaurants (QSRs) is and actually always has been a pretty innovative space. The drive-thru window, for example, first met the market in 1947 when it was introduced to the world by Sheldon “Red” Chaney, operator of Red’s Giant Hamburg in Springfield, Missouri.
